How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Spring Valley?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Spring Valley 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,775 | $1,320 | $2,079 |
Spring Valley 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,149 | $1,440 | $2,592 |
Spring Valley 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,420 | $1,965 | $2,903 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Gated Spring Valley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Gated Spring Valley Apartment?
The average rent for a Gated Apartment in Spring Valley is $2,005.
What is the largest Gated Spring Valley Apartment for rent?
Today's Gated apartment with the most square footage in Spring Valley is a 1,477 square feet unit starting from $1,714 at Skyline at Westfall Station.
What is the average size for Spring Valley Gated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Gated rental in Spring Valley is currently at 692 sq ft.
